The administration of nirsevimab was associated with protection against respiratory syncytial virus (RSV) infection for up to 12 months in children younger than 24 months, with reductions in the odds ...
In a test-negative case-control study of 274 hospitalized infants aged 90 days or younger, maternal RSVpreF vaccination was associated with 67.6% effectiveness against RSV-associated acute respiratory ...
